a better way is to include your admin pages.

if ($myrow[Admin] == "Y"){
 include("admin.php");
 }else{
  include("user.php")  ;
 }

so you can also include at the top of this example a general header with
menu's etc.

> Please note, that this is a very insecure way of determining which page a
> person gets to view.  All they would have to do is enter the admin.php url
> in the browser and they get admin access even if they are not admins.
